#375caa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#375caa is composed of 21.6% red, 36.1% green and 66.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.6% cyan, 45.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 33.3% black. It has a hue angle of 220.7 degrees, a saturation of 51.1% and a lightness of 44.1%. #375caa color hex could be obtained by blending #6eb8ff with #000055.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

#375caa color description : Dark moderate blue.

#375caa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#375caa has RGB values of R:55, G:92, B:170 and CMYK values of C:0.68, M:0.46, Y:0,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 3628202.

Shades and Tints of #375caa

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020407 is the darkest color, while #f7f9fc is the lightest one.
